Hey folks, this is Artificial Lure, your go-to guy for Hudson River fishin' right here in the heart of NYC. It's April 27, 2026, and we're kickin' off the day at 3 AM Eastern—perfect time to hit the water before the city wakes up. Tides today are runnin' steady with a low coefficient around 34, meanin' slack currents and not much swing between high at about 4 AM and low near 8 PM—fish'll be holdin' tight in eddies. Weather's lookin' prime: mild temps in the 50s risin' to low 60s, light southerly breeze, partly cloudy skies. Sunrise at 6:05 AM, sunset 7:50 PM, givin' us a solid 13.5 hours of light for striper chasin'. Fish activity's pickin' up this spring—solunar charts say low overall, but don't sleep on it; outgoing tides fire 'em up. Recent reports show limits of 3-4 pound striped bass hammerin' around the city, plus schoolies, some big stripers to 20 pounds, catfish, and early shad runs. Anglers pulled 20-pound bags last week on incoming flows. Best lures? Go with **swimbaits** like 4-inch paddle tails in chartreuse for stripers, or **jerkbaits** rigged weedless.
